Summary

This position is located in the Small Business Administration, Government Contract Business Development - HQ in Washington, D.C. The incumbent prepares policy analyses of SBA's government contracting and business development programs for SBA decisionmakers and for Congress.

Duties

Help

  • Procurement Policy Analysis and Reporting: Develop analytical reports on small business. Generate annual reports regarding small business program performance. Assists in conducting analysis of each agency's performance against negotiated small business contracting goals. Identifies discrepancies, shortfalls, trends, and areas requiring improvement through data analysis and benchmarking.
  • Procurement Policy Liaison and Representation: Assists Senior Procurement Analyst in representing and advocating for SBA's government contracting and business development programs on interagency councils and committees focused on federal acquisition policy and operations.
  • Procurement Policy Research: Conducts preliminary analysis on current and emerging policies, regulations, laws, and economic trends impacting small business participation in federal contracting.

Recent Graduates Program Eligibility:
To qualify for the Recent Graduates Program, applicants must have completed all requirements of an academic course of study leading to an associates, bachelor's, master's, professional, doctorate, vocational, or technical degree or qualifying certificate program from an accredited educational institution within the 2 years preceding the closing date of this announcement. Preference-eligible veterans who, due to military service obligations, were precluded from applying to the Program during any portion of the 2-year eligibility period are entitled to a full 2-year period of eligibility upon release or discharge from active duty. In no event, however, may the eligibility period extend beyond 6 years from the date on which the preference eligible veteran completed the requirements of an academic course of study.

RECENT GRADUATE PROGRAM COMPLETION AND CONVERSION: Upon completion of the minimum 1-year career development program, Program participants may, at agency discretion, be non-competitively converted without a break in service, to a term or permanent position in the competitive service. There is no guarantee for conversion.

To be eligible for conversion, Recent Graduates must:

  • Successfully complete the developmental minimum-one-year period identified.
  • Demonstrate successful job performance.
  • Meet the qualifications for the position to which the Recent Graduate will be converted.
  • Complete 40 hours of formal interactive training within developmental period.
  • Sign a Pathways Programs Participant Agreement upon appointment.
  • Meet established goals outlined in the Recent Graduate's Individual Development Plan (IDP).
  • Be recommended by supervisor/manager for conversion to permanent OR term position (these term positions may later be non-competitively converted to permanent positions).
Non-competitive conversions must occur upon successful completion of the one year Program period or at the end of an approved, NTE 120-day extension. If not converted on the date of their service requirement as listed on the Participant Agreement or at the end of an approved 120-day extension, their appointment must be terminated.

If you meet basic requirements for the position, your application will be evaluated and placed into one of three categories:

1. Best-Qualified: highly proficient with an overall comprehensive level of knowledge, skills and abilities related to the job based on a complete review of experience, education, and training as described in an applicant's responses to the assessment questions and resume.
2. Well-Qualified: competent in the position with an overall accomplished level of knowledge, skills, and abilities related to the job based on a complete review of experience, training, and education as applicable, as described in an applicant's responses to the assessment questions and resume.
3. Qualified: an overall basic level of knowledge, skills, and abilities related to the job based on a complete review of experience, education, and training, as described in an applicant's responses to the assessment questions and resume.

Candidates eligible for veterans' preference will be placed ahead of other candidates in the appropriate category for which they have been rated. Additionally, preference eligibles who have a compensable service-connected disability of at least 10 percent and who meet Minimum Qualification Requirements will automatically be placed in the Best Qualified Category.
